Output 77fc6101b3f2429404c074fd51d7042ef4166aff7c5cfa04bb4f27452c43607f:3

value
1987089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67439a87d75e43efbba6f5c81666455e99aa1673 OP_EQUAL
address
3B72WV6WXrHXkPj939YmcaNJjWKKMwTRkE
transaction
77fc6101b3f2429404c074fd51d7042ef4166aff7c5cfa04bb4f27452c43607f
spent
true